Create a publishing schedule

Viewers expect content updates on a regular basis, so it's important to think of your videos in terms of campaigns rather than randomly posting your videos. Think of the stories you can tell and break them up into multiple parts by posting a new update every week. After determining the content of your videos, create a publication schedule. Establishing and maintaining a consistent publishing schedule will encourage viewers to come back for more videos. You can also spread out your videos over time and use them to guide viewers to a big product launch or an exciting announcement.
